My GF recently purchased a ''98 Amigo, 4 cylinder, manual trans. At very random times it makes this horrible grinding sound...coming from the rear passenger side. It will not do this while sitting still so I am unable to pinpoint the sound. There is also a wierd squeaking sound coming from the engine on the driver''s side. It will make this sound while sitting still, but is also very difficult to pin point. Any suggestions would be appreciated. Thanks! |
jack the vehicle up and turn the wheels maybe you can locate the noise in the rear that way. The water pump and timing belt are located on the front check those items for the engine noise.
